FMR 57 General - The Gambia: a haven for refugees?

Series
Syrians in displacement (Forced Migration Review 57)
Audio Embed
Although not usually thought of as a haven of refugee protection, the Gambia has a fairly sizeable refugee population and some sophisticated legal frameworks and protection mechanisms.
